Doubting Thomas Farms

1. Doubting Thomas Farms

94%
(18)
46mi from Detroit Lakes · 2 sites
We just rebooted since 2022! Call or txt us at arrival time as we are a real working farm. Dry camping. We are a sixth-generation family farm, deeply rooted in the land and home to a wide variety of wildlife. Certified in both water quality and organic practices, we are committed to sustainability through cover cropping and regenerative farming methods. Our farm grows rare tribal seeds, Row 7 seed varieties, and specialty grains sought after by some of the nation’s top award-winning chefs. We supply grains for artisan bread, bagel shops, and even the Japanese market. In addition, we offer consumer-ready pancake mixes, flours, and rolled oats. Our work has been featured on the Food Network and in national publications. Noreen, our lead farmer, was honored as the first woman to receive the University of Minnesota’s prestigious Siehl Lifetime Achievement Award. Come learn more about our land: This is a working organic farm with chickens, vegetables, and grains. You'll find wide open spaces, vibrant sunsets, a clear view of the stars at night, and a peaceful river nearby. Lots of area to walk, and fish or see the night sky. We also very close to Fargo, Nd and Moorhead, Mn about 12 miles. Lots to do there as well and we can share our favorite places.

Mikko Kamp on the 4th Crow

2. Mikko Kamp on the 4th Crow

97%
(106)
47mi from Detroit Lakes · 2 sites
Very private 4 acre campsite in stand of Norway Pines and Birch overlooking the 4th Crow Wing Lake. - NOTE: This is now (2023) a single site with two (2) power stands. Not off grid, but close to it. There is no potable water, just a peaceful Pine and Birch wooded area overlooking the lake. Ideal if you’re camping with friends/family. Pull your RV's in or pitch a tent and stay as long as you like. 8 miles south of Nevis in the Heartland Lakes area. Adjacent 8 acres of 'Common Use' woods and picnic area with dock for fishing. Or bring a canoe/Kayak to launch. 4th Crow is NOT a recreational lake, but great for fishing, waterfowl and wildlife spotting. Fire pit, picnic table and swing on site. 9 miles from Heartland Biking Trail and within 3 miles of OHV/Snowmobile trails access. Wonderful public swimming beach 3 miles away on Big Stony Lake.

AN UNEXPECTED GREEN ISLAND

6. AN UNEXPECTED GREEN ISLAND

42mi from Detroit Lakes · 1 site
Green Island is an unexpected pine forest located actually inside a small town in northcentral Minnesota. The camping area is incredibly private and surrounds a small pond. It is primitive with minimal amenities beyond an outhouse and hand pump for water. Accessibility is only for tenting or truly tiny camper vehicles. The campground is a huge semi-shaded space for up to 20 tents, still, we prefer 1 or 2 at a time. However, larger group retreats are possible. We are serious environmentalists and we offer this opportunity just for true nature lovers as singles or couples, who totally take care of themselves, leave absolutely no trace, and are solid environmental stewards. In other words, its no place for a party. Separate from the campground there are: apple orchards, outdoor sculptures, wildlife, a meditation kuti, and perfect spaces for forest therapy. Yet almost unbelieveably, you can walk to a Pizza Hut or Walmart in 5 minutes. This is an excellent staging point for outdoors people en route to Itasca State Park, The Lost Fourty, and the state and national forests of the north.

Timberlost at West Crooked

7. Timberlost at West Crooked

49mi from Detroit Lakes · 1 site
West Crooked Lake Resort offers relaxation and enjoyment for the entire family on 20 acres of seclude woods. You can enjoy sun bathing on the sandy beach, swimming in the clear water, playing on the Rave Water Park, or reading a book in the shade. Listen to the loons calling, watch eagles soar overhead, glide through the clear waters in a canoe or paddleboat, or just bring a book, relax, and catch some rays on the sandy beach. Many area attractions are just minutes from the resort. Biking/walking trails, golf courses, casinos, challenge course, a local winery, horseback riding, shopping and restaurants are just a few of the attractions you will find. In addition, the Headwaters of the Mississippi in Itasca State Park is just 30 minutes from the resort. ATV riders enjoy hundreds of miles of trails in the Park Rapids Lakes Area, bringing them closer to nature's beauty in remote areas others often don't see. Local clubs maintain two primary trails in our area, which are connected with miles of trails along county highways/byways.  Drive your ATV directly to the trails from our resort. West and Middle Crooked Lakes are part of the famous Mantrap chain of lakes – the very heart of Northern Minnesota’s finest fishing country. Fish to catch in West Crooked Lake include Northern, Walleye, Bass and Panfish. You can fish right off the dock at the resort or venture out to the many inlets on this quiet lake. When on the lake, you will often find yourself enjoying the tranquil beauty of West Crooked Lake with no other boats in sight.
